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ements represent the amount of money a player must wager before they can withdraw any winnings associated with a bonus. These requirements are typically exp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ount or the deposit amount plus the bonus amount. For instance, a wagering requirement of 30x the bonus amount means that a player must wager 30 times the value of the bonus before they can cash out. Understanding these requirements is crucial for players to avoid disappointment and maximize the value of their bonuses. Often, different games contribute differently to the wagering requirement, with slots generally contributing 100% while table games may contribute a smaller percentage. This affects the optimal strategy for bonus clearing.

The Importance of Licensing and Regulation
A valid license from a recognized regulatory authority is a strong indicator of a casino's legitimacy and commitment to fair play. These authorities impose strict standards for security, fairness, and responsible gaming. Licensing ensures that the casino operates within a legal framework and is subject to independent oversight. Players should always verify that a casino holds a valid license before depositing any funds. The licensing jurisdiction provides a recourse for players in case of disputes or concerns. Transparency regarding licensing information is a sign of a trustworthy and accountable operator.
